This patch makes the code and documentation for the program match, removes 
dead
code, and slightly improves (IMHO) the way the program goes about its 
business. Also,
it adds an "XXX" comment about how usage of this program and its 
supporting libraries
has drifted from the initial intent, and calls attention to two ways of 
bringing things back
into line.

-# Generate a Perl module from the operation definitions in an .ops file.
+# Generate a Perl module from the operation definitions in .ops files.
+#
+# The first .ops file on the command line is read in and its name is used 
to
+# determine the name of the Perl module that will contain the op info.
+#
+# Any remaining .ops files on the command line are read in, and their op
+# info objects are appended, in order, to the op info array obtained from 
the
+# first .ops file.
+#
+# WARNING: Generating a combined Perl module for a set of .ops files that
+# you do not later turn into a combined opcode table with the same 
content
+# and order is a recipe for disaster.
+# 
+# XXX: The original design of the .ops processing code was intended to be 
a
+# read-only representation of what was in a particular .ops file. It was
+# not originally intended that it was a mechanism for building a bigger
+# virtual .ops file from multiple physical .ops files. This code does 
half of
+# that job (the other half is getting them to compile together instead of
+# separately in a *_ops.c file). You can see evidence of this by the way 
this
+# code reaches in to the internal OPS hash key to do its concatenation, 
and
+# the way it twiddles each op's CODE hash key after that. If the op and 
oplib
+# Perl modules are going to be used for modifying information read from 
..ops
+# files in addition to reading it, they should be changed to make the 
above
+# operations explicitly supported. Otherwise, the Parrot build and 
interpreter
+# start-up logic should be modified so that it doesn't need to 
concatenate 
+# separate .ops files.
